• Condensation
- (n.) A rearrangement or concentration of the different constituents of one or more substances into a distinct and definite compound of greater complexity and molecular weight, often resulting in an increase of density, as the condensation of oxygen into ozone, or of acetone into mesitylene.
- (n.) The act or process of reducing, by depression of temperature or increase of pressure, etc., to another and denser form, as gas to the condition of a liquid or steam to water.
- (n.) The act or process of condensing or of being condensed; the state of being condensed.

• Condenser
- (n.) One who, or that which, condenses.
- (n.) An instrument for concentrating electricity by the effect of induction between conducting plates separated by a nonconducting plate.
- (n.) An instrument for condensing air or other elastic fluids, consisting of a cylinder having a movable piston to force the air into a receiver, and a valve to prevent its escape.
- (n.) An apparatus, separate from the cylinder, in which the exhaust steam is condensed by the action of cold water or air. See Illust. of Steam engine.
- (n.) An apparatus for receiving and condensing the volatile products of distillation to a liquid or solid form, by cooling.
- (n.) A lens or mirror, usually of short focal distance, used to concentrate light upon an object.
